Key Ideas and Details
RL1

Cite the textual evidence that most strongly
supports an analysis of what the text says explicitly
as well as inferences drawn from the text.
Making Inferences
Draw conclusions about ideas in a text that are not directly stated.

Marking a Text
Identify, circle and underline essential ideas in a text.

Marking a Text
Identify and isolate essential ideas in a text.

Socratic Seminar
Engage in a structured academic discussion that focuses on a text that has been read.

Three Group Socratic Seminar
Work in teams of three to discuss a text and share ideas with all members in a Socratic circle.

RL2

Determine a theme or central idea of a text and
analyze its development over the course of the text,
including its relationship to the characters, setting,
and plot; provide an objective summary of the text.
Investigative Reading
Pause while reading to explore and examine ideas in a text.

Read 1, Speak 2, Write 3
Read a paragraph or two, discuss the text, and write down main ideas.

Sequence/Process Organizer
Summarize how events, individuals, or ideas develop over time or summarize steps in a process.

Story Summary Poster
Visually represent the main message or central theme in a story.

Summarizing Main Ideas
Identify the main ideas in a paragraph(s) and synthesize them into a few concise sentences.
